Default Limits Stay the Same in Texas

Looks like the Texas trout limits won't change--yet

COASTAL BEND — The Texas Parks & Wildlife Commission Wednesday decided not to pursue a change in the daily limit of speckled trout as a coastwide regulation.

TPW Coastal Fisheries Director Robin Riechers recommended against the change from the current 10 fish limit at a Wednesday commission meeting in Austin.

The department received a record 1,243 comments from individuals, businesses, organizations on this issue. These comments came from seven scoping meetings, by e-mail, through the TPW website and Facebook page, by mail and by phone. The Corpus Christi scoping meeting had the highest attendance with more than 100 people.

The overall opinions submitted for or against change (1,229) were split 49 percent to 51 percent, with 608 favoring some kind of change and 621 favoring the status quo. A smattering of others did not clearly state what they wanted. Of the folks who favored change, about 52 percent (315 comments) suggested a five-fish daily bag. About 36 percent of the change group suggested some other form of harvest regulation, ranging from keeping the first 10 fish to changing the minimum harvest length or designing various slot rules that limited the number of bigger trout (females) we could keep.
